Symptoms

  • •Engine temperature gauge reading higher than normal
  • •Steam rising from under the hood
  • •Warning lights illuminated on the dashboard (e.g., check engine light)
  • •Reduced engine performance or power loss
  • •Unusual noises from the engine (e.g., knocking or pinging)
  • •Coolant fluid leaking under the vehicle

Solution
1. Preparation
  • Gather tools and materials: OBD-II scanner, coolant, socket set, torque wrench, screwdriver set, and shop towels.
  • Ensure the vehicle is parked on a level surface and allow the engine to cool completely before proceeding.
2. Inspect and Fill Coolant
  • Remove the radiator cap carefully to avoid steam burns.
  • Check the coolant level; if low, add the appropriate coolant mixture (50% antifreeze, 50% water) to the reservoir and radiator.
  • Replace the radiator cap securely.
3. Replace Thermostat (if faulty)
  • Drain the coolant from the radiator into a suitable container.
  • Remove the thermostat housing using a socket set (typically 10-12 Nm torque).
  • Replace the old thermostat with a new one, ensuring the orientation is correct.
  • Reinstall the housing and tighten to manufacturer specifications.
  • Refill the coolant system.
4. Check and Replace Water Pump (if necessary)
  • Disconnect the battery.
  • Remove any components obstructing access to the water pump (e.g., serpentine belt).
  • Unbolt the water pump from the engine and remove it.
  • Install the new water pump and torque bolts to specifications.
  • Reattach the serpentine belt and reconnect the battery.
5. Test Radiator Fan Operation
  • Start the engine and allow it to reach normal operating temperature.
  • Observe for radiator fan activation; if it does not engage, replace the fan motor or relay as needed.
